Migrate to Shoehorn Why shoehorn? shoehorn lets you pass partial data in tests while keeping TypeScript happy. It replaces as assertions with type-safe alternatives. Test code only. Never use shoehorn in production code. Problems with as in tests: Trained not to use it Must manually specify target type Double-as ( as unknown as Type ) for intentionally wrong data Install npm i @total-typescript/shoehorn Migration patterns Large objects with few needed properties Before: type Request = { body : { id : string } ; headers : Record < string , string
; cookies : Record < string , string
; // ...20 more properties } ; it ( "gets user by id" , ( ) => { // Only care about body.id but must fake entire Request getUser ( { body : { id : "123" } , headers : { } , cookies : { } , // ...fake all 20 properties } ) ; } ) ; After: import { fromPartial } from "@total-typescript/shoehorn" ; it ( "gets user by id" , ( ) => { getUser ( fromPartial ( { body : { id : "123" } , } ) , ) ; } ) ; as Type → fromPartial() Before: getUser ( { body : { id : "123" } } as Request ) ; After: import { fromPartial } from "@total-typescript/shoehorn" ; getUser ( fromPartial ( { body : { id : "123" } } ) ) ; as unknown as Type → fromAny() Before: getUser ( { body : { id : 123 } } as unknown as Request ) ; // wrong type on purpose After: import { fromAny } from "@total-typescript/shoehorn" ; getUser ( fromAny ( { body : { id : 123 } } ) ) ; When to use each Function Use case fromPartial() Pass partial data that still type-checks fromAny() Pass intentionally wrong data (keeps autocomplete) fromExact() Force full object (swap with fromPartial later) Workflow Gather requirements - ask user: What test files have as assertions causing problems? Install and migrate : Install: npm i @total-typescript/shoehorn Find test files with as assertions: grep -r " as [A-Z]" --include=".test.ts" --include=".spec.ts" Replace as Type with fromPartial() Replace as unknown as Type with fromAny() Add imports from @total-typescript/shoehorn Run type check to verify
